Jonny gets strike for midnight chocolate raid

Jonny has been given an official strike from Big Brother. He hid under a blanket to steal food from the rich side in the early hours of this morning.

The fireman has become the third housemate to be given an official strike, joining Kate and Spencer.

"They threw the book at me in there," he said, on leaving the Diary Room.

Last night's raid saw Jonny squeezing through the bars to steal chocolate for himself, Kate and Spencer. But Jonny was then ordered to the Diary Room, and told he had to give what was left back to Big Brother.
